一种基于区块链的智能摄像方法与系统与流程

文档序号:18411531发布日期:2019-08-13 18:22阅读:356来源:国知局
一种基于区块链的智能摄像方法与系统与流程

本发明涉及摄像设备技术领域,尤其涉及一种基于区块链的智能摄像方法与系统。



背景技术:

最近几年随着无线网络速度的大幅提高,各种视频应用业务得到了极大的发展,特别是视频作品拍摄以及直播业务的出现,推动了摄像系统的大力发展,出现了各类摄像设备,包括手机的高清拍摄镜头、便携式摄像头、自拍相机设备、专业拍摄设备等等。借助于这些摄像设备,视频拍摄相关的业务也逐渐成为了互联网行业的一支新生力量,视频拍摄的商业应用得到了发展,例如视频作品的购买与观看,付费的视频直播业务、直播业务中的表演即时变现业务等等。由于这些业务都是基于视频服务平台展开的,所以观众的各类支付形式都要通过服务平台及相关中介平台来完成,而各种客户信息、支付方式和交易记录一般也都保存在服务平台和中介平台上,由于现在的视频服务平台都由中心服务器提供,故也存在一定的安全风险,客户信息、支付信息、客户浏览记录都有被黑客侵犯或者交易的可能,故这类传统的基于普通摄像系统的视频商业服务的安全问题应该得到解决。

区块链技术是个体之间在不需要互信的情况下进行大规模协作的工具,被应用于许多传统的中心化领域中,处理一些原本由中介机构处理的交易,其可靠的安全信任机制可解决现今互联网或物联网技术的核心缺陷,如传统的互联网和物联网模式由一个中心化的数据中心来收集所有信息,区块链技术能在无需信任单个节点的同时创建整个网络的信任共识,从而很好地解决互联网和物联网的一些核心缺陷,让物与物之间不仅相连起来,而且能自发活动起来,区块链技术拥有开放、不可篡改、可追溯等特性。针对视频传播相关服务,将区块链与摄像设备及技术相结合,能够更加安全可靠地为视频制作者、视频传播者以及视频收看者提供服务。



技术实现要素:

为了克服现有技术的不足,本发明提出一种基于区块链的智能摄像方法与系统。根据区块链的规则对普通摄像设备进行软硬件更新,形成一套智能摄像系统,该摄像系统能成为一个独立的拍摄、传播、存储、交易、显示系统,该系统在加入区块链网络成为一个网络节点后,可以更好地为用户提供商业化的视频服务。

为了达到上述目的,本发明解决其技术问题所采用的技术方案是:一种基于区块链的智能摄像方法与系统,该系统是整个区块链网络中的一个用于视频服务的节点,硬件系统包括:摄像模块、音频输入输出模块、显示模块、视频数据存储模块、区块链控制模块、身份验证模块、网络接口模块、控制模块。

所述摄像模块就是用于拍摄和制作视频的设备,该模块还具备视频编辑、视频压缩等功能。

所述音频输入输出模块用于视频拍摄时声音录制和声音播放的设备,该模块还具备音频编辑、音频压缩等功能。

所述显示模块是用于显示图像、视频、账户信息、交易信息的模块,包括来自摄像模块的图像或视频,以及来自网络端的图像和视频、来自区块链控制模块的账户信息和交易信息。

所述视频数据存储模块用于存储摄像模块拍摄的图像或视频数据。该视频数据存储模块对于整个摄像系统可以采用内置式的存储,也可采用外置扩充的存储。

所述区块链控制模块用于保存和操作区块链上的数据,包括区块链网络中的各种交易数据和用户身份信息数据,智能合约的建立和执行等,其中智能合约可采用以太坊来实现。

所述身份验证模块可以是基于摄像模块的人脸识别模块,也可以是带有指纹识别系统的身份验证模块,或其他能验证用户身份的模块,其用途是在摄像系统开机时用户登录和用户进行交易时对用户的身份进行验证。

所述网络模块是用于所述基于区块链的智能摄像系统连接到外界互联网和区块链网络的接口,用于在互联网上和其它用户之间传输视频数据,以及用于在区块链网络中与其他用户之间进行支付交易,以及各类区块链交易认证工作,网络模块一般采用无线网络接入模块,例如wifi模块、4g接入模块等。

所述控制模块用于控制以上所述摄像模块、音频输入输出模块、显示模块、视频数据存储模块、区块链控制模块、身份验证模块、网络接口模块各模块相互之间的信号传输及供电。

本发明所述基于区块链的智能摄像方法包括以下步骤:

a.当基于区块链的智能摄像系统希望加入视频服务时,那么通过填写一系列的个人信息以及视频服务信息,再经过视频服务平台上资质审查后就可以作为一个节点加入该区块链网路中,同时,关于该智能摄像系统的信息被自动发送并保存到区块链网络中的各个节点中,可以获得各个节点的认可。

b.在基于区块链的智能摄像系统中的区块链控制模块中包含了事先置入的各种智能合约,这些智能合约对应的各种视频服务菜单在视频显示中所显示,视频服务菜单中包括了视频服务提供者所能提供的各种视频服务项目及其价格。当有客户发起视频服务请求时,视频服务提供者通过对摄像系统进行操作,接受该服务订单,此时智能合约自动生效。当视频服务结束后,双方的账户交易自动完成,智能合约完成工作,交易信息被发往各个区块链节点保存。

本发明的有益效果是,传统的以视频服务平台为中心的视频服务应用被分布式的视频服务应用所取代,即基于区块链的视频服务应用,而基于区块链的视频服务应用包括基于区块链的智能拍摄方法和系统,该系统是一个独立的视频服务提供装置,该装置在视频服务应用中采用点对点的服务,包括视频服务和交易服务,交易服务由事先设置好的智能合约完成,同时交易信息将保存在整个区块链网络的各个节点上,使得整个交易安全程度得到了极大的提高,另外区块链节点的加入也需要得到其他大多数节点的认可,故使得整个视频服务应用的可信任度得到了提高,智能合约的引入也避免了许多不必要的商业纠纷。

附图说明

为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。

图1是基于区块链的智能摄像系统结构图

图2是基于区块链的智能摄像系统外观结构图

图3是视频服务应用中区块链控制模块的功能结构图

图4是视频服务应用中区块链控制模块的网络架构图

具体实施方式

为了使本发明的目的、技术方案及有益效果更加清楚明白,以下结合附图及实施例,对本发明进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于限定本发明。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。

本实施例以智能摄像设备在区块链网络中的视频服务实现为例,对基于区块链的智能摄像方法和系统进行说明,图1展示了基于区块链的智能摄像系统结构图,图2是基于区块链的智能摄像系统外观结构图,图3展示了视频服务应用中区块链控制模块的功能结构图,图4是视频服务应用中区块链控制模块的网络架构图。

在图1所示基于区块链的智能摄像系统结构图中,各个功能模块、各模块之间相互连接关系、各模块之间信号输入输出关系被显示。

所述图1中,所述控制模块处于中心位置,被用来连接摄像模块、音频输入输出模块、显示模块、视频数据存储模块、区块链控制模块、身份验证模块和网络接口模块,并与所有模块之间进行信号输入输出和供电。

所述摄像模块用于在视频拍摄过程中进行图像的录制,摄像模块不仅仅是摄像头,还具备视频编辑功能、数据压缩功能。

所述音频输入输出模块用于在视频拍摄过程中声音的录制以及声音的播放,音频输入输出模块不仅仅是麦克风和扬声器,还具备音频编辑功能、数据压缩功能。

所述视频数据存储模块用于保存摄像模块和音频输入输出模块录制的视频和声音信号,供各种音视频应用提取。摄像模块和音频输入模块录制的信号通过控制模块传输到视频数据存储模块。

所述区块链控制模块用于将摄像系统加入区块链网络,成为区块链网络中的一个节点,同时负责视频应用相关的智能合约的执行,智能合约可采用以太坊来实现。

所述显示模块用于显示视频数据和视频服务交易相关信息,显示模块提供了一个好的人机交互功能,控制模块控制各种信息在显示模块上进行显示。

所述身份验证模块用于摄像系统开机时身份认证和视频服务交易时进行区块链节点账户id认证功能,摄像系统开机时可以允许多个用户进行身份认证后使用该摄像系统进行视频拍摄,但是视频服务交易时只允许一个用户通过身份认证,因为视频服务交易时只有一个区块链节点账户id与该摄像系统相关联。

所述网络接口模块可以是wifi模块或4g模块等,用于将摄像系统连接到网络上,为客户提供视频服务,并利用区块链网络进行视频服务的交易。

所述图2为展示了基于区块链的智能摄像系统的外观结构图实例,从外观结构上,该系统包括摄像模块、指纹识别模块、显示模块、第一麦克风、第二麦克风、第一扬声器、第二扬声器、开关和机箱。其中所述指纹识别模块是用于实现身份验证的模块;所述第一麦克风和第二麦克风是音频输入输出模块的一部分,采用两个麦克风能更有效地进行声音录制;所述第一扬声器和第二扬声器是音频输入输出模块的一部分,采用两个扬声器能获得更好的播放效果;所述开关是整个摄像系统的开关;所述机箱是承载以上各功能模块以及内部各功能模块的设备;所述摄像头处于机箱上面;所述显示模块处于机箱前面和摄像头下面位置。上述各模块的逻辑位置能更好地为视频服务提供者带来好的视频服务操作体验。当然,基于区块链的智能摄像系统的外观可以具有其他形式,而且系统上还可以增加更多麦克风达到降噪等更好的音频录制效果,增加更多扬声器达到更好的音频立体声播放效果。

本发明专利中区块链控制模块是有别于其他摄像系统的最重要区别,所述图3是视频服务应用中区块链控制模块的功能结构图,本实施例中所述区块链控制模块包括区块链节点的id、视频服务提供者信息、视频服务信息和视频服务的智能合约。所述区块链控制模块中的信息可根据实际情况有所增加或减少,但区块链节点的id和智能合约两个最基本的功能模块是必须的。视频服务信息和视频服务的智能合约条款也可以根据实际情况进行更改。在进行视频服务交易时区块链节点id的认证是通过上述图1中身份验证模块来实现的。

为了实现本实施例中基于区块链的交易,也即智能摄像方法和系统中的区块链控制模块为了完成所述图3的功能,需要在区块链各层中实现相应的功能,即图4所示视频服务应用中区块链控制模块的网络架构图,该网络架构可通过以太坊实现。摄像系统前台所显示的用户交互内容为区块链控制模块应用层中的内容,而合约共识层和网络数据层在后台运行。通过上述图4中区块链节点的三层架构,区块链控制模块能完成在区块链网络中的视频服务交易。

本发明的原理己经通过实施例或操作模式的实例在上面进行了描述。然而本发明不应该被解释为限于上面讨论的特定实施例,例如,本发明对不同功能外观的智能摄像系统同样有效。

上述或多或少特定的实施例因此应该被认为是说明性的,而不是限制性的,并且应该理解的是,本领域技术人员可以在所述实施例中作出变化,而不背离由所附的权利要求所限定的本发明的范围。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1